#968795 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#968795 is composed of 58.8% red, 52.9%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 10% magenta, 0.7%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 304 degrees, a saturation of 6.7% and a lightness of 55.9%. #968795 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#2d0f2b.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

Shades and Tints of #968795

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060505 is the darkest color, while #fbfafb is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#968795 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#8d8d8d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#8f8c8f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#90909c Protanopia 1% of men
  • #9a8d9a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#9a8d97 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#928d99 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#988b98 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#998b96 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
